your arizona fall bucket list for 2026 🍂🍁✨ here a your arizona fall bucket list for 2026 🍂🍁✨

here are 6 places to see fall colors this year (fall starts in 6 weeks!!)

🍁 aspen corner in flagstaff

🍁 downtown flagstaff

🍁 see spring trail below the mogollon rim

🍁 fish creek trail off highway 88

🍁 west fork trail in oak creek canyon, sedona

🍁 boyce thompson arboretum

arizona in august: ☀️☔️🌲🛶🍹 phoenix is still hot a arizona in august: ☀️☔️🌲🛶🍹

phoenix is still hot as heck (average highs around 105°), but it’s also peak monsoon season (the prediction is looking good), the mountains are in the 70s and 80s (great time to go up north on the weekend), wildflowers are blooming (flagstaff), waterfalls are flowing (after a good rain), and days are slowlyyyy getting shorter!
